WebJul 17, 2015 · 7 Answers. A cross-validation is often used, for example k -fold, if the aim is to find a fit with lowest RMSEP. Split your data into k groups and, leaving each group out in turn, fit a loess model using the k -1 groups of data and a chosen value of the smoothing parameter, and use that model to predict for the left out group.
